Which of the following transition will have a wavelength different than that observed in rest of the transitions ?

A

H-atoms , transition from 3rd level to 1st level .

B

`He^(1+)` ion , transition from 5th excited state to 1st excited state .

C

`Li^(2+)` ion , transition from 9th level to 3rd level.

D

`Be^(+3)` ion, transition from 11th excited state to 3rd level .

Text Solution

Verified by Experts

The correct Answer is:
D
